Barbara June Martin, 88, of Greenville, TX, born February 29, 1936, has passed away on February 24, 2025, at home. She was the daughter of the late Alice Ward Terry and Loyd “Bud” Terry. She was born and raised in Rains County, TX, and graduated from Miller Grove High School. Barbara worked in billing and was an outside saleswoman for The Office Place in Greenville, TX for 20 years, and then, she was a faithful caregiver to her mother Alice for many years. She was a devoted wife of 41 years to the late Billy Dean Martin, and a loving, nurturing, strong mother for her four children. She is preceded in death by her husband Bill, and son, Bill Jr., her parents, her brother Loyd Terry, and her granddaughters, Ashley Sanford, and Rebecca Martin. She is survived by her daughters, Terri Murphey of Grand Prairie, TX, and Tanya Walker and husband Sammy of Greenville, TX, her son, Steve Martin and wife Cathy of Houston, TX, her sister Shirley Sayes of Pineville, Louisiana, and her brother Dr. James Terry and wife Fran of Mesquite, TX, as well as fourteen grandchildren, fourteen great-grandchildren and many nieces and nephews. All who knew her loved her and will forever remember her fondly. Barbara was an avid reader, lover of games, cards, crosswords, and spending time with her family. A good game of Scrabble was always a favorite. She was a devoted member to Park St. Baptist Church of Greenville, TX. Her favorite scripture was Matthew 28:20 - “...And remember that I am always with you until the end of time.” Barbara was a one-of-a-kind human being, and her existence on this Earth brightened the lives of everyone she met. She will be deeply missed, forever.
A date for a Celebration of Life is pending at this time.
